Urinary Tract Health
Cranberries are well-known for their ability to support urinary tract health. They contain compounds called proanthocyanidins, which can help prevent bacterial adhesion in the urinary tract, reducing the risk of urinary tract infections. Drinking cranberry apple juice regularly may help maintain a healthy urinary tract.
Heart Health
Another potential benefit of cranberry apple juice is its positive impact on heart health. Both cranberries and apples are rich in antioxidants, particularly flavonoids. These antioxidants can help reduce the risk of heart disease by preventing the oxidation of LDL cholesterol, improving blood flow, and reducing inflammation in the arteries.
